Operation 5 Times / Timer 1A

Operation LED blinks 5 times and Timer LED shows 1A — Compressor location error.

Fujitsu · 410A Multi-Zone Mini-Split Systems

What does Operation 5 Times / Timer 1A mean?

The compressor speed is not synchronizing with the control signal, or the compressor failed to start.

Common Causes

  • 2-way or 3-way valves on the refrigerant lines are not fully open.
  • Compressor malfunction (e.g., winding resistance issue, loose leak wire).
  • Problem with the refrigeration cycle condition.

Repair Steps & Checklist

Click steps to track your progress.

  1. 1

    Reset the power to the unit by turning it off at the circuit breaker, waiting 30 seconds, then turning it back on.

  2. 2

    Ensure that any manual valves on the refrigerant lines (if accessible) are fully open.

  3. 3

    If the error persists, professional service is needed to inspect the compressor and refrigeration cycle.
